Alaska Airlines today announced a firm order of 20 737 MAX 8, 17 737MAX 9s, and 13 Next-Generation 737-900ERs. This order, which has a list price of $5 billion at the moment, is the largest ever placed by Alaska Airlines. Alaska Airlines currently has 120 Boeing 737s.
Which airlines also fly the Boeing 737 Max Boeing had 5,011 orders from 79 customers as of January 31, 2019. The top three airline customers for the 737 MAX were Southwest Airlines (280), Flydubai (251 orders) and Lion Air (201 orders).

Which planes does Alaska Air use?
Alaska Air Group maintains an operating fleet of:
- 166 Boeing 737 aircraft with an average age 9.1 years.
- 71 Airbus A320 aircraft with an average age 8.6 years.
- 33 Bombardier Q400 aircraft have an average age 11.7 years.
- 30 Embraer 175 aircraft have an average age of 1.6.
